news 2026/5/8 17:46:13

传统登录开发vsAI生成:HLW045LIFE案例效率对比

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
传统登录开发vsAI生成:HLW045LIFE案例效率对比

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
请生成两份HLW045LIFE登录系统的代码:1. 传统方式手动编写的版本;2. AI自动生成的版本。要求两个版本功能完全一致,包含:用户名密码登录、苹果账号登录、表单验证。然后对比两者的代码行数、开发时间预估和性能指标,生成详细的对比报告。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

传统登录开发vsAI生成:HLW045LIFE案例效率对比

最近在开发一个名为HLW045LIFE的官网登录系统时,我尝试了两种完全不同的开发方式:传统手动编码和AI自动生成。这个登录系统需要实现三个核心功能:基础用户名密码登录、苹果账号第三方登录以及表单验证。下面分享我的实践过程和对比结果。

开发过程对比

  1. 传统手动开发流程手动开发时,我先用HTML搭建了登录表单的结构,包含用户名、密码输入框和提交按钮。然后编写CSS样式让界面更美观,这部分花了约1小时。接着用JavaScript实现表单验证逻辑,包括非空检查、密码长度验证等,又消耗了2小时。最后集成苹果登录的OAuth2.0认证流程是最耗时的,需要阅读苹果开发者文档、申请API密钥、处理回调等,前后用了4个多小时。

  2. AI生成开发流程在InsCode(快马)平台上,我直接输入需求描述:"生成一个包含用户名密码登录和苹果账号登录的页面,需要表单验证"。平台在30秒内就给出了完整代码。我只需要检查生成的代码是否符合需求,然后进行微调,整个过程不超过15分钟。

代码质量对比

  1. 代码量
  2. 手动版本:HTML 45行,CSS 78行,JavaScript 132行,总计255行
  3. AI生成版本:HTML 38行,CSS 65行,JavaScript 98行,总计201行

  4. 性能指标使用Chrome开发者工具测试页面加载时间:

  5. 手动版本:首屏加载1.8秒,完整交互准备就绪2.3秒
  6. AI生成版本:首屏加载1.2秒,完整交互准备就绪1.6秒

  7. 功能完整性两个版本都完整实现了:

  8. 用户名密码登录功能
  9. 苹果账号OAuth2.0登录
  10. 前端表单验证
  11. 错误提示和成功跳转

效率对比分析

  1. 时间成本
  2. 手动开发总耗时:约7小时
  3. AI生成总耗时:15分钟
  4. 效率提升:28倍

  5. 维护成本AI生成的代码结构更规范,注释更完整,变量命名更合理,后期维护和修改明显更容易。

  6. 学习成本手动开发需要掌握OAuth2.0等专业知识,而AI生成几乎不需要专业知识门槛。

实际体验建议

通过这次对比,我发现对于标准化的功能模块,使用AI生成可以大幅提升开发效率。特别是InsCode(快马)平台的一键部署功能,让生成的代码可以直接在线运行测试,省去了本地环境配置的麻烦。

对于开发者来说,我的建议是: - 标准化功能优先考虑AI生成 - 复杂业务逻辑仍需人工开发 - 生成代码后要进行充分测试 - 合理利用平台部署功能快速验证

这次实践让我深刻体会到AI辅助开发带来的效率革命,特别是对中小型项目和标准化功能模块的开发,节省的时间成本非常可观。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
请生成两份HLW045LIFE登录系统的代码:1. 传统方式手动编写的版本;2. AI自动生成的版本。要求两个版本功能完全一致,包含:用户名密码登录、苹果账号登录、表单验证。然后对比两者的代码行数、开发时间预估和性能指标,生成详细的对比报告。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/4 22:19:55

用AI在Ubuntu 24.04上快速搭建开发环境

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个Ubuntu 24.04下的Python开发环境配置脚本。要求:1. 自动检测系统版本和硬件配置 2. 安装Python 3.10和pip 3. 创建虚拟环境 4. 安装常用开发工具包(numpy,pand…

作者头像 李华
网站建设 2026/4/23 19:09:11

不用写代码!用快马AI快速构建GDB调试原型

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 请生成一个快速验证用的C程序原型和配套GDB调试方案。程序模拟生产者-消费者问题,包含共享缓冲区、互斥锁和条件变量。要求:1) 故意引入一个竞态条件bug 2)…

作者头像 李华
网站建设 2026/4/20 2:21:43

AI如何解决Vue.js未检测到的常见问题

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个Vue.js项目检测工具,能够自动扫描项目目录,检查Vue.js是否正确安装和配置。工具应包含以下功能:1. 检查node_modules中Vue.js是否存在&…

作者头像 李华
网站建设 2026/5/3 19:00:09

零基础教程:用EASYAIOT搭建第一个物联网项目

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个适合新手的智能花盆项目,要求:1. 使用通俗语言描述需求(当土壤干燥时自动浇水,手机可查看状态);2. …

作者头像 李华
网站建设 2026/4/23 18:33:38

零基础玩转MINDSDB:第一个预测模型15分钟上手

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个极简的MINDSDB入门教程应用,分步骤演示:1) Docker安装MINDSDB 2) 导入CSV示例数据 3) 编写预测查询 4) 解释结果输出。每个步骤提供可视化操作界面…

作者头像 李华
网站建设 2026/5/7 3:02:36

LED限流电阻计算方法:新手必看实用指南

从零搞懂LED限流电阻:不只是算个数,更是电路设计的第一课你有没有试过把一个LED直接插到5V电源上?啪的一声,光没了——不是灯亮了,是烧了。这几乎是每个电子新手都踩过的坑。看起来只是一个小小的发光二极管&#xff0…

作者头像 李华